On average, 3-star hotels in Xanthi cost £68 per night, and 4-star hotels in Xanthi are £101 per night. If you're looking for something really special, a 5-star hotel in Xanthi can on average be found for £136 per night (based on Booking.com prices).

Xanthi is beautiful town.
Xanthi is beautiful town. Very multicultural with a greek and turkish muslim population. The old town is beautiful with its old buildings dating back many years. The narrow cobblestone streets are wondering to walk through and always offer a surprise.
The food is wonderful and typical of the area.
We would definitely love to visit Xanthi again.
